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- 2023-02-10 First Reading Ways and Means
referral-committee - 2023-02-13 Hearing 2/28 at 1:00 p.m.
- 2023-03-13 Favorable with Amendments Report by Ways and Means
committee-passage-favorable - 2023-03-14 Favorable with Amendments {
committee-passage-favorable - 2023-03-14 Motion Special Order until 3/15 (Delegate Tomlinson) Adopted
- 2023-03-15 Floor Amendment {
- 2023-03-15 Second Reading Passed with Amendments
- 2023-03-16 Third Reading Passed
passage - 2023-03-16 Referred Education, Energy, and the Environment
referral-committee - 2023-04-07 Favorable with Amendments Report by Education, Energy, and the Environment
committee-passage-favorable - 2023-04-07 Favorable with Amendments {
committee-passage-favorable - 2023-04-07 Second Reading Passed with Amendments
- 2023-04-10 Third Reading Passed
passage - 2023-04-10 House Concurs Senate Amendments
- 2023-04-10 Third Reading Passed
passage - 2023-04-10 Passed Enrolled
- 2023-04-24 Approved by the Governor - Chapter 157
executive-signature
